Title:
TRANSFORMED YEAST FOR CONSTRUCTING COMBINATORIAL PROTEIN LIBRARY
Document Type and Number:
WIPO Patent Application WO/2002/002749
Kind Code:
A1
Abstract:
It is intended to provide a yeast capable of expressing and presenting a protein of a relatively large size on the cell surface layer. A transformed yeast which is obtained by transferring a DNA library comprising an expression vector of a yeast having a gene encoding the protein to be expressed into a yeast.
